Game Warden Dawson Murchison was shot and killed while patrolling the Concho Game Preserve on the King Ranch for illegal poachers.

He and another warden were attempted to arrest two men who were spotlighting deer.

The incident occurred near the line between Kleberg County and Jim Wells County. The suspects fled to Mexico and was never apprehended.

Game Warden Murchison had served with the Texas Game, Fish, and Oyster Commission for 10 years. He was survived by his wife, three sons, two daughters, two sisters, and three brothers.
